Institutions as Robust and Resilient, Dynamic, Human, Time-Travelling, Cognitive Communities

2025-04-16

Abstract excerpt

<p>Institutions are a pervasive feature of human social life, but psychological science has largely ceded the study of institutions to disciplines such as economics, sociology, political science, history, and law.
